Mary A. Line
Apr 07, 1923 - Jul 04, 2017
Mary A. Line passed away July 4th, 2017, in Overland Park, KS. She was born on the family farm in rural Lyon County, KS, on April 7, 1923. She was preceded in death by her husband, Merlin E. Line, granddaughter Charley Line, son Richard Line and parents Flora and Grover Gasche.

 

Mary was one of seven children and spent her early childhood helping on the family farm.. She attended high school in Emporia, KS, and then attended Kansas State University, graduating in 1944. She met Merlin while in Manhattan and they married in 1943. Merlin served in the US Army, in Europe during WWII. Mary was a dietitian at Mt. Sinai Hospital in Philadelphia, PA.

 

In 1949 they moved to Lakin, KS, where Merlin became the Kearney County Extension Agent. Upon retirement, they moved to Manhattan, KS. Mary enjoyed many activities with her friends and neighbors in both Lakin and Manhattan. Her church was always important to her, first being a member of the Lakin United Methodist Church and later the Manhattan First United Methodist Church.

 

Both were avid KSU Wildcat fans and were season ticket holders to both KSU basketball and football games. Being a cancer survivor, Mary was active in the cancer support group in Manhattan. In 2013, she moved to Overland Park, and truly enjoyed being close to her family. She was known fondly as “Grandma Great” by her family.
